The Cybersecurity Risks Most Businesses Aren’t Even Looking At

Most organizations today have strong firewalls, antivirus tools, and employee security training. But what if the biggest risk isn’t on your network — it’s sitting in plain sight, right in your office?

Multifunction printers (MFPs), scan-to-email workflows, cloud storage, and untracked paper output remain some of the most exploited — and least protected — access points in modern businesses. And they’re often completely ignored once the firewall is in place.

In regulated industries like healthcare, education, finance, and legal, or any environment that handles sensitive customer or operational data, that’s an expensive oversight. Let’s explore the security blind spots most organizations underestimate — and how to close them before cybercriminals find them first.
